Pork Ramen Soup

(89)
Hands On Time:
30 mins
Total Time:
30 mins
Yield:
4 serves

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on canola oil

  • 2 boneless pork chops (1/2 inch thick; about 1/2 pound total)

  • kosher salt and black pepper

  • 8 scallions, sliced, white and green parts separated

  • 1 2-inch piece fresh ginger, peeled and sliced

  • 6 cups low-sodium chicken broth

  • 2 3-ounce packages ramen noodles (discard the seasoning packets)

  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ce

  • 1 large carrot, grated

  • 2 radishes, halved and thinly sliced

  • ½ cup fresh cilantro leaves

Directions

  1. Heat the oil in a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Season the pork with ¼ teaspoon each salt and pepper and cook until cooked through, 2 to 3 minutes per side. Let rest for 5 minutes before thinly slicing.

  2. Add the scallion whites and ginger to the drippings in the Dutch oven. Cook, stirring, until softened, 1 to 2 minutes. Add the broth and bring it to a boil. Add the noodles and boil, stirring occasionally, until tender, 2 to 3 minutes. Stir in the soy sauce.

  3. Serve the soup topped with pork, carrot, radishes, cilantro, and scallion greens.

Nutrition Facts (per serving)

315 Calories
8g Fat
37g Carbs
24g Protein
Nutrition Facts
Calories 315
% Daily Value *
Total Fat 8g 10%
Saturated Fat 2g 10%
Cholesterol 40mg 13%
Sodium 782mg 34%
Total Carbohydrate 37g 13%
Total Sugars 4g
Protein 24g 48%
Calcium 42mg 3%
Iron 1mg 6%
